The Medical-Social Centres have the mission to help people of all ages who are dependent or affected in their health to remain in their living environment as long as possible and to support their caregivers. APREMADOL, with its 4 MSCs, serves 7 municipalities in the western Lausanne area.

Your mission
As a somatic nurse case manager, you take on the role of case manager. You perform and delegate quality services to ensure the health, safety and well-being of clients at home. At their place of residence, you define with them the most appropriate solutions for their situation, thus developing a privileged relationship of trust.

Your main responsibilities
- Assess the clinical needs of the client and build their personalised care plan in partnership with them and their relatives
- Visit clients and provide the services planned in the intervention plan.
- Ensure network management and collaborate closely with care and home help staff while ensuring the quality of services.
- Document follow-ups in the electronic file according to institutional guidelines, thus ensuring continuity of care.
- Create and maintain lasting links with partners in the regional medico-social network (professionals, volunteers, user groups).
- Assume the role of case manager in the overall follow-up of situations: assessment, orientation, advice, support in administrative procedures.
